How Much Weed Does Snoop Dogg Smoke Daily and What Does His Blunt Roller Earn?

Snoop Dogg has become synonymous with cannabis culture, with his consumption habits becoming almost as legendary as his music career. The rapper's relationship with marijuana has sparked curiosity about exactly how much weed Snoop Dogg smokes a day and the unique position of his professional blunt roller.

Snoop Dogg's Daily Cannabis Consumption

According to various interviews and reports, Snoop Dogg's daily cannabis consumption is substantial. The rapper has claimed to smoke approximately 81 blunts per day. This figure came from a 2013 Twitter Q&A where Snoop answered "81 blunts a day x 7" when asked about his smoking habits.

While this number may seem extraordinarily high, it would mean smoking a blunt roughly every 12 minutes during waking hours. Some context is important: Snoop often smokes in social settings where blunts are passed around, so he may not be consuming each one entirely by himself.

In terms of quantity, if each blunt contains roughly 1 gram of cannabis, Snoop's claimed consumption would be around 81 grams daily. For perspective, the average cannabis user typically consumes 0.5-1 gram per day. Understanding typical weed quantities helps put Snoop's consumption in context.

Snoop's Professional Blunt Roller: Salary and Responsibilities

One of the most fascinating aspects of Snoop's cannabis consumption is that he employs a professional blunt roller (PBR). In a 2019 appearance on Howard Stern's show, Snoop confirmed that he pays his blunt roller between $40,000-$50,000 annually, plus perks like free travel and merchandise.

The salary has reportedly increased since then. In 2022, Snoop mentioned on Twitter that he had given his roller a raise due to inflation, bringing the annual salary closer to $50,000-$60,000.

The responsibilities of Snoop's blunt roller include:

  • Ensuring a constant supply of perfectly rolled blunts
  • Timing the preparation to have blunts ready when needed
  • Traveling with Snoop to ensure availability
  • Maintaining quality and consistency
  • Managing cannabis storage and freshness

Snoop's Smoking History and Cannabis Journey

Snoop's relationship with cannabis began at an early age. Snoop's smoking journey reportedly started when he was around 12-13 years old in his hometown of Long Beach, California.

Over the decades, Snoop has evolved from a consumer to an advocate and businessman in the cannabis industry. His consumption habits have remained relatively consistent throughout his career, though there have been periods where he claimed to reduce or modify his intake.

In late 2023, Snoop caused confusion when he announced he was "giving up smoke," which many interpreted as quitting cannabis. However, this turned out to be a clever marketing campaign for a smokeless fire pit company. Exploring these rumors reveals that Snoop continues to consume cannabis, though he may have adjusted his methods of consumption over time.

Snoop's Cannabis Business Ventures

Snoop's relationship with cannabis extends beyond consumption. He has built a business empire around the plant, including:

  • Leafs By Snoop: His own cannabis brand offering flowers, concentrates, and edibles
  • Casa Verde Capital: A venture capital firm focusing on the cannabis industry
  • Partnership with Canopy Growth: A major Canadian cannabis producer
  • Media ventures like "Mary + Jane" and various cooking shows with Martha Stewart

These business ventures demonstrate how Snoop has leveraged his personal brand and cannabis expertise into legitimate business opportunities as legalization has spread across the United States and globally.

The Impact and Legacy of Snoop's Cannabis Advocacy

Beyond the impressive numbers and business ventures, Snoop's openness about his cannabis consumption has played a significant role in changing public perception of the plant. As one of the first mainstream celebrities to openly embrace cannabis, Snoop helped normalize its use decades before legalization movements gained momentum.

His advocacy has contributed to reduced stigma and increased acceptance of cannabis in popular culture. Through his music, media appearances, and business ventures, Snoop has consistently portrayed cannabis as a positive influence in his life, helping to counter negative stereotypes.
